Bacardi enters TN market

BS Reporter Chennai

Bacardi India Pvt Ltd, the wholly-owned subsidiary of Bacardi Ltd, today announced its entry into the Tamil Nadu beverages market, by launching two products – Bacardi Superior Rum and Eristoff Vodka. The company has tied up with Chennai-based SNJ Distillers, for bottling these products for the Tamil Nadu market.

Speaking to reporters after launching the company's brands in Chennai, Arvind Krishnan, general manager (marketing), Bacardi India Pvt Ltd, said that till now, the company was importing the products to cater the Tamil Nadu market, which resulted in higher cost compared to other products.

“Through the tie-up with SNJ Distillers for bottling the products in the state, the product prices are expected to be considerably lower than the earlier prices,” he said.

 

He noted that, once the company start bottling at Chennai, the prices of the products would be a third of its imported products.

The company has said it would launch few more brands in the state that are currently available in other metros, said Krishnan. He declined to comment further.

The products will be manufactured in SNJ's bottling unit in Kakkabhiranpuram village, near Chennai, said S N Jayamurugan, chairman and managing director, SNJ Distillers Pvt Ltd.

Currently the company has a capacity to produce 900,000 cases per month, of which the current capacity utilisation is nearly 600,000 cases per month.

Bacardi India Pvt Ltd, a fully-owned subsidiary of Bacardi Ltd, supplies products to the rest of the country from its core distillery in Nanjangode, Karnataka.
